| /xsrc/external/mit/MesaLib.old/dist/src/gallium/auxiliary/tgsi/ |
| H A D | tgsi_from_mesa.c | 62 unsigned *semantic_index) 67 *semantic_index = 0; 71 *semantic_index = 0; 75 *semantic_index = 0; 79 *semantic_index = 1; 83 *semantic_index = 0; 87 *semantic_index = 1; 91 *semantic_index = 0; 95 *semantic_index = 0; 99 *semantic_index 59 tgsi_get_gl_varying_semantic(gl_varying_slot attr,bool needs_texcoord_semantic,unsigned * semantic_name,unsigned * semantic_index) argument 174 tgsi_get_gl_frag_result_semantic(gl_frag_result frag_result,unsigned * semantic_name,unsigned * semantic_index) argument [all...] |
| H A D | tgsi_from_mesa.h | 39 unsigned *semantic_index); 48 unsigned *semantic_index);
|
| H A D | tgsi_ureg.c | 116 unsigned semantic_index; member in struct:ureg_program::__anon00333c4a0308 131 unsigned semantic_index; member in struct:ureg_program::__anon00333c4a0408 137 unsigned semantic_index; member in struct:ureg_program::__anon00333c4a0508 286 unsigned semantic_index, 302 ureg->input[i].semantic_index == semantic_index) { 317 ureg->input[i].semantic_index = semantic_index; 339 unsigned semantic_index, 347 semantic_name, semantic_index, interp_mod 284 ureg_DECL_fs_input_cyl_centroid_layout(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index,enum tgsi_interpolate_mode interp_mode,unsigned cylindrical_wrap,enum tgsi_interpolate_loc interp_location,unsigned index,unsigned usage_mask,unsigned array_id,unsigned array_size) argument 337 ureg_DECL_fs_input_cyl_centroid(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index,enum tgsi_interpolate_mode interp_mode,unsigned cylindrical_wrap,enum tgsi_interpolate_loc interp_location,unsigned array_id,unsigned array_size) argument 366 ureg_DECL_input_layout(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index,unsigned index,unsigned usage_mask,unsigned array_id,unsigned array_size) argument 382 ureg_DECL_input(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index,unsigned array_id,unsigned array_size) argument 396 ureg_DECL_system_value(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index) argument 424 ureg_DECL_output_layout(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index,unsigned streams,unsigned index,unsigned usage_mask,unsigned array_id,unsigned array_size,boolean invariant) argument 501 ureg_DECL_output_array(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index,unsigned array_id,unsigned array_size) argument 1509 emit_decl_semantic(struct ureg_program * ureg,unsigned file,unsigned first,unsigned last,enum tgsi_semantic semantic_name,unsigned semantic_index,unsigned streams,unsigned usage_mask,unsigned array_id,boolean invariant) argument 1580 emit_decl_fs(struct ureg_program * ureg,unsigned file,unsigned first,unsigned last,enum tgsi_semantic semantic_name,unsigned semantic_index,enum tgsi_interpolate_mode interpolate,unsigned cylindrical_wrap,enum tgsi_interpolate_loc interpolate_location,unsigned array_id,unsigned usage_mask) argument [all...] |
| H A D | tgsi_ureg.h | 175 unsigned semantic_index, 187 unsigned semantic_index, 197 unsigned semantic_index, 203 semantic_index, 212 unsigned semantic_index, 217 semantic_index, 229 unsigned semantic_index, 238 unsigned semantic_index, 245 unsigned semantic_index); 250 unsigned semantic_index, 195 ureg_DECL_fs_input_cyl(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index,enum tgsi_interpolate_mode interp_mode,unsigned cylindrical_wrap) argument 210 ureg_DECL_fs_input(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index,enum tgsi_interpolate_mode interp_mode) argument [all...] |
| /xsrc/external/mit/MesaLib/dist/src/gallium/auxiliary/tgsi/ |
| H A D | tgsi_from_mesa.c | 64 unsigned *semantic_index) 69 *semantic_index = 0; 73 *semantic_index = 0; 77 *semantic_index = 0; 81 *semantic_index = 1; 85 *semantic_index = 0; 89 *semantic_index = 1; 93 *semantic_index = 0; 97 *semantic_index = 0; 101 *semantic_index 61 tgsi_get_gl_varying_semantic(gl_varying_slot attr,bool needs_texcoord_semantic,unsigned * semantic_name,unsigned * semantic_index) argument 184 tgsi_get_gl_frag_result_semantic(gl_frag_result frag_result,unsigned * semantic_name,unsigned * semantic_index) argument [all...] |
| H A D | tgsi_from_mesa.h | 44 unsigned *semantic_index); 53 unsigned *semantic_index);
|
| H A D | tgsi_ureg.c | 119 unsigned semantic_index; member in struct:ureg_program::ureg_input_decl 133 unsigned semantic_index; member in struct:ureg_program::__anon428a1b5d0308 139 unsigned semantic_index; member in struct:ureg_program::ureg_output_decl 288 unsigned semantic_index, 303 ureg->input[i].semantic_index == semantic_index) { 317 ureg->input[i].semantic_index = semantic_index; 338 unsigned semantic_index, 345 semantic_name, semantic_index, interp_mod 286 ureg_DECL_fs_input_centroid_layout(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index,enum tgsi_interpolate_mode interp_mode,enum tgsi_interpolate_loc interp_location,unsigned index,unsigned usage_mask,unsigned array_id,unsigned array_size) argument 336 ureg_DECL_fs_input_centroid(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index,enum tgsi_interpolate_mode interp_mode,enum tgsi_interpolate_loc interp_location,unsigned array_id,unsigned array_size) argument 364 ureg_DECL_input_layout(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index,unsigned index,unsigned usage_mask,unsigned array_id,unsigned array_size) argument 380 ureg_DECL_input(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index,unsigned array_id,unsigned array_size) argument 394 ureg_DECL_system_value(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index) argument 422 ureg_DECL_output_layout(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index,unsigned streams,unsigned index,unsigned usage_mask,unsigned array_id,unsigned array_size,boolean invariant) argument 499 ureg_DECL_output_array(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index,unsigned array_id,unsigned array_size) argument 1507 emit_decl_semantic(struct ureg_program * ureg,unsigned file,unsigned first,unsigned last,enum tgsi_semantic semantic_name,unsigned semantic_index,unsigned streams,unsigned usage_mask,unsigned array_id,boolean invariant) argument 1578 emit_decl_fs(struct ureg_program * ureg,unsigned file,unsigned first,unsigned last,enum tgsi_semantic semantic_name,unsigned semantic_index,enum tgsi_interpolate_mode interpolate,enum tgsi_interpolate_loc interpolate_location,unsigned array_id,unsigned usage_mask) argument [all...] |
| H A D | tgsi_ureg.h | 177 unsigned semantic_index, 188 unsigned semantic_index, 197 unsigned semantic_index, 202 semantic_index, 214 unsigned semantic_index, 223 unsigned semantic_index, 230 unsigned semantic_index); 235 unsigned semantic_index, 246 unsigned semantic_index, 254 unsigned semantic_index); 195 ureg_DECL_fs_input(struct ureg_program * ureg,enum tgsi_semantic semantic_name,unsigned semantic_index,enum tgsi_interpolate_mode interp_mode) argument [all...] |
| /xsrc/external/mit/MesaLib/dist/src/microsoft/compiler/ |
| H A D | dxil_signature.h | 42 uint32_t semantic_index; // Semantic Index member in struct:dxil_signature_element
|
| /xsrc/external/mit/MesaLib.old/dist/src/gallium/auxiliary/draw/ |
| H A D | draw_pipe_flatshade.c | 168 uint semantic_name, uint semantic_index) 175 semantic_index < 2) { 176 interp = indexed_interp[semantic_index]; 186 semantic_index == fs->info.input_semantic_index[j]) { 252 draw->extra_shader_outputs.semantic_index[j]); 167 find_interp(const struct draw_fragment_shader * fs,int * indexed_interp,uint semantic_name,uint semantic_index) argument
|
| H A D | draw_context.c | 544 uint semantic_name, uint semantic_index) 550 slot = draw_find_shader_output(draw, semantic_name, semantic_index); 561 draw->extra_shader_outputs.semantic_index[n] = semantic_index; 636 uint semantic_name, uint semantic_index) 643 info->output_semantic_index[i] == semantic_index) 650 draw->extra_shader_outputs.semantic_index[i] == semantic_index) { 543 draw_alloc_extra_vertex_attrib(struct draw_context * draw,uint semantic_name,uint semantic_index) argument 635 draw_find_shader_output(const struct draw_context * draw,uint semantic_name,uint semantic_index) argument
|
| H A D | draw_private.h | 319 uint semantic_index[10]; member in struct:draw_context::__anon406ac0650d08 413 uint semantic_name, uint semantic_index);
|
| H A D | draw_pipe_clip.c | 728 uint semantic_name, uint semantic_index) 735 semantic_index < 2) { 736 interp = indexed_interp[semantic_index]; 758 semantic_index == fs->info.input_semantic_index[j]) { 864 draw->extra_shader_outputs.semantic_index[j]); 727 find_interp(const struct draw_fragment_shader * fs,int * indexed_interp,uint semantic_name,uint semantic_index) argument
|
| /xsrc/external/mit/MesaLib/dist/src/gallium/auxiliary/draw/ |
| H A D | draw_pipe_flatshade.c | 168 uint semantic_name, uint semantic_index) 175 semantic_index < 2) { 176 interp = indexed_interp[semantic_index]; 186 semantic_index == fs->info.input_semantic_index[j]) { 252 draw->extra_shader_outputs.semantic_index[j]); 167 find_interp(const struct draw_fragment_shader * fs,int * indexed_interp,uint semantic_name,uint semantic_index) argument
|
| H A D | draw_context.c | 597 uint semantic_name, uint semantic_index) 603 slot = draw_find_shader_output(draw, semantic_name, semantic_index); 614 draw->extra_shader_outputs.semantic_index[n] = semantic_index; 691 uint semantic_name, uint semantic_index) 698 info->output_semantic_index[i] == semantic_index) 705 draw->extra_shader_outputs.semantic_index[i] == semantic_index) { 596 draw_alloc_extra_vertex_attrib(struct draw_context * draw,uint semantic_name,uint semantic_index) argument 690 draw_find_shader_output(const struct draw_context * draw,uint semantic_name,uint semantic_index) argument
|
| H A D | draw_private.h | 395 uint semantic_index[DRAW_MAX_EXTRA_SHADER_OUTPUTS]; member in struct:draw_context::__anone553aa981108 504 uint semantic_name, uint semantic_index);
|
| H A D | draw_pipe_clip.c | 739 uint semantic_name, uint semantic_index) 746 semantic_index < 2) { 747 interp = indexed_interp[semantic_index]; 769 semantic_index == fs->info.input_semantic_index[j]) { 875 draw->extra_shader_outputs.semantic_index[j]); 738 find_interp(const struct draw_fragment_shader * fs,int * indexed_interp,uint semantic_name,uint semantic_index) argument
|
| /xsrc/external/mit/MesaLib/dist/src/gallium/auxiliary/nir/ |
| H A D | nir_to_tgsi_info.c | 153 unsigned semantic_name, semantic_index; local in function:gather_intrinsic_load_deref_info 155 &semantic_name, &semantic_index); 159 info->colors_read |= mask << (semantic_index * 4); 498 unsigned semantic_name, semantic_index; local in function:nir_tgsi_scan_shader 527 &semantic_name, &semantic_index); 530 info->input_semantic_index[i] = semantic_index; 596 unsigned semantic_name, semantic_index; local in function:nir_tgsi_scan_shader 612 &semantic_name, &semantic_index); 616 semantic_index++; 620 &semantic_name, &semantic_index); 773 unsigned semantic_name, semantic_index; local in function:nir_tgsi_scan_shader [all...] |
| H A D | nir_to_tgsi.c | 130 unsigned *semantic_name, unsigned *semantic_index) 138 *semantic_index = location - VARYING_SLOT_VAR0; 143 semantic_name, semantic_index); 199 unsigned semantic_name, semantic_index; local in function:ntt_output_decl 201 &semantic_name, &semantic_index); 202 semantic_index += semantics.dual_source_blend_index; 215 out = ureg_DECL_output(c->ureg, semantic_name, semantic_index); 217 unsigned semantic_name, semantic_index; local in function:ntt_output_decl 220 &semantic_name, &semantic_index); 240 semantic_name, semantic_index, 129 ntt_get_gl_varying_semantic(struct ntt_compile * c,unsigned location,unsigned * semantic_name,unsigned * semantic_index) argument 346 unsigned semantic_name, semantic_index; local in function:ntt_setup_inputs 411 unsigned semantic_name, semantic_index; local in function:ntt_setup_outputs 1683 unsigned semantic_name, semantic_index; local in function:ntt_emit_load_input [all...] |
| /xsrc/external/mit/MesaLib.old/dist/src/gallium/drivers/radeonsi/ |
| H A D | si_shader_nir.c | 78 unsigned semantic_name, semantic_index; local in function:gather_intrinsic_load_deref_info 80 &semantic_name, &semantic_index); 84 info->colors_read |= mask << (semantic_index * 4); 422 unsigned semantic_name, semantic_index; local in function:si_nir_scan_shader 467 &semantic_name, &semantic_index); 470 info->input_semantic_index[i] = semantic_index; 524 unsigned semantic_name, semantic_index; local in function:si_nir_scan_shader 539 &semantic_name, &semantic_index); 543 semantic_index++; 547 &semantic_name, &semantic_index); [all...] |
| /xsrc/external/mit/MesaLib.old/dist/src/gallium/auxiliary/gallivm/ |
| H A D | lp_bld_tgsi_info.c | 617 unsigned semantic_index = info->base.output_semantic_index[index]; local in function:lp_build_tgsi_info 619 semantic_index < PIPE_MAX_COLOR_BUFS) { 620 info->cbuf[semantic_index] = info->output[index];
|
| /xsrc/external/mit/MesaLib.old/dist/src/gallium/drivers/llvmpipe/ |
| H A D | lp_setup_point.c | 249 unsigned semantic_index = shader->info.base.input_semantic_index[slot]; local in function:setup_point_coefficients 253 if (semantic_index < PIPE_MAX_SHADER_OUTPUTS && 254 (setup->sprite_coord_enable & (1u << semantic_index))) {
|
| /xsrc/external/mit/MesaLib/dist/src/gallium/auxiliary/gallivm/ |
| H A D | lp_bld_tgsi_info.c | 625 unsigned semantic_index = info->base.output_semantic_index[index]; local in function:lp_build_tgsi_info 627 semantic_index < PIPE_MAX_COLOR_BUFS) { 628 info->cbuf[semantic_index] = info->output[index];
|
| /xsrc/external/mit/MesaLib.old/dist/src/mesa/state_tracker/ |
| H A D | st_program.c | 506 unsigned semantic_name, semantic_index; local in function:st_translate_vertex_program 508 &semantic_name, &semantic_index); 510 output_semantic_index[slot] = semantic_index; 1452 unsigned semantic_name, semantic_index; local in function:st_translate_program_common 1454 &semantic_name, &semantic_index); 1456 input_semantic_index[slot] = semantic_index; 1488 unsigned semantic_name, semantic_index; local in function:st_translate_program_common 1490 &semantic_name, &semantic_index); 1492 output_semantic_index[slot] = semantic_index;
|
| /xsrc/external/mit/MesaLib/dist/src/mesa/state_tracker/ |
| H A D | st_program.c | 633 unsigned semantic_name, semantic_index; local in function:st_translate_vertex_program 635 &semantic_name, &semantic_index); 637 output_semantic_index[slot] = semantic_index; 1756 unsigned semantic_name, semantic_index; local in function:st_translate_common_program 1758 &semantic_name, &semantic_index); 1760 input_semantic_index[slot] = semantic_index; 1792 unsigned semantic_name, semantic_index; local in function:st_translate_common_program 1794 &semantic_name, &semantic_index); 1796 output_semantic_index[slot] = semantic_index;
|